An inguinal hernia happens when tissue pushes through a weak spot in the lower abdominal wall. While some hernias may start small, they don’t heal on their own and can become painful or lead to complications over time. Inguinal hernia repair is a common outpatient procedure, often performed using minimally invasive (laparoscopic) techniques that result in less pain and faster recovery. Most patients return home the same day and resume normal activities within a short time.
